Agago ARDC Oweka Bostify “Balaam” inspects Lapirin HC III, listens to health workers’ concerns
By Our Reporter
AGAGO, UGANDA: Assistant Resident District Commissioner (Asst. RDC) for Agago District, Oweka John Bostify, popularly known as “Balaam of Agago,” on has visited Lapirin Health Centre III in Lukole Sub-county, Agago County, Agago District to reakly assess service delivery at the facility.

During the visit on 19th August 2026, Clmmissiiner John Bostify interacted with health workers, listened to their concerns and observed first-hand some of the challenges affecting health service delivery at the moment.
Sources at the facility said the Asst. RDC toured the health centre and engaged staff on issues ranging from drug supply, staffing gaps to the state of infrastructure.
Bostify, who is known in Agago for his hands-on monitoring of government programmes, has in recent months intensified field visits across parishes to track implementation of the Parish Development Model (PDM), with emphasis on corruption and accountability.
At Lapirin HC III, his focus was on understanding the situation on the ground and hearing directly from frontline health workers.
Residents in Lukole welcomed the visit, saying regular monitoring by RDCs helps to improve accountability and responsiveness in health facilities.
The Assistant RDC Bostufy cautioned that punctuality is paramount for all staff as he congratulated the incharge of Lapirin HC III for being a hardworking person.
He commendes president Yoweri Museveni for increasing the salary of Health workers and tge payment of medical intern saying it is a way of motivating health workers and urged them to work very hard always.
